I started to have this issue once I have flashed the newest (05) kernel. I was hoping that the routing problems were caused by the 03 kernel (I was wrong) so I flashed the newest one.
When I plug in the headset (the one that came with the x10 mini) the whole phone hangs. After about 15-30 seconds it reboots and if the headset isn't removed, the phone stops booting in the middle of the kernel's loading screen animation. Also, no logcat messages are printed out just before the crash.
ROM (if it helps in any way): miniCM10-4.1.0-robyn

I have the same problem with the U20i (mimmi), with the kernel 2.6.32.61-nAa-jb-06 and also with the previous version, 2.6.32.60-nAa-jb-05 (I haven't tested the olders).
When I plug the headset the phone freeze as described by Paulius5.
I have tested with different roms: Minicm10 (different versions) , and MiniCM7-2.2.2, and the same problem. I changed to the kernel 2.6.29.6-nAa-14 (with MiniCM7) and the problem disappear, when I connect the headphone, instantaneously appear the information about the media volume.
